In the August 18, 1989, issue of the Will Street Journal there appeared an article entitled "Program Trading Spreads from Just Wall Street Firms." Following are two quotations from that article:

Brokerage firms in the business, which tiptoed back into program trading after the post-crash furor died down, argue that such strategies as stock-index arbitragerapid trading between stock index futures and stocks to capture fleeting price differences-link two related markets and thus benefit both.

The second quotation in the article is from a senior vice president at Twenty-First Securities Corp:

Program trading is a product that is here, links markets, and it is not going to disappear. It is a function of the computerization of Wall Street.

Do you agree with these statements?
